Course Content

• Patient Rights and Responsibilities
• Informed Consent: Legal and Ethical Considerations
• Advanced Care Planning: Durable Power of Attorney for Healthcare & Living Wills
• Decision-Making Capacity Assessment (DMC)
• Communication Skills for Supporting Patient Autonomy
• Ethical Dilemmas in Patient Autonomy and Healthcare
• Cultural Sensitivity and Patient Autonomy
• End-of-Life Care and Patient Choice
• The Role of Technology in Supporting Patient Autonomy (eHealth & telehealth)
• Patient Advocacy and Empowerment
